Why Nuts? In the season finale, the lead character, Jake (Skeet Ulrich) recounts a story his grandfather told him about a statement made by General McAuliffe during WWII. In this tale, when asked to surrender by the Germans he simply replied "Nuts" as a way of saying "We will NOT surrender - Go to Hell!"

On May 16th, 2007, CBS made the monumentally fatal error in judgement and cancelled what had been one of it’s best new shows for 2006-2007... Jericho.

But Jericho fans reacted...
Immediately upon cancellation, many of us decided to embark on a mission to let CBS know what we think... That they had underestimated the show’s fans... and that due only to its own decision to put the show on haitus for 2 months mid-season, to programming mistakes and a poor marketing strategy did the ratings drop.
